About The Position

Ivy Tech-Bloomington is looking for an individual to join their team as a College and Career Coach. In this role, the successful candidate will support high school students in exploring career pathways, developing postsecondary plans, and pursuing opportunities such as technical certifications, dual credit, dual enrollment, and degree programs. This position works closely with students, families, high school partners, and Ivy Tech staff to provide career guidance, facilitate college and career planning, and strengthen connections between secondary and postsecondary education. The role also serves as an Ivy Tech representative in local high schools and helps students navigate admissions, enrollment, and pathway completion. GENERAL PURPOSE AND SCOPE OF THE POSITION: The College and Career Coach will work to improve the number of students pursuing a strong post-secondary pathway, which could include technical certifications, associate degrees and other post-secondary degrees including career and technical education (CTE). The position will plan and implement outreach services in conjunction with industry representatives, school corporations, and post-secondary institutions. This work is aimed at helping students define their career aspirations and to recognize technical and community college programs that can help them achieve their educational and career goals.

Responsibilities

  • Provide regular career counseling for high school students to help them discover fulfilling, successful careers.
  • Work with students individually to complete a Career Interest Inventory, and post-secondary education plan all designed to meet career/employability goals.
  • Prepare and share information on career exploration and job market statistics to facilitate students’ postsecondary planning.
  • Develop a strategic plan to guide them through their high school and college years and achieve their career goals.
  • Provide support for students pursuing dual credit and dual enrollment programming. This may include assisting and advising them about the process of enrollment and registration as part of pathway completion. This may include helping students through Dual Enroll, assessment, and transfer credit discussions.
  • Serve as liaison for dual credit matters by communicating regularly with high school staff, students, and parents.
  • Communicate in writing and through regularly scheduled meetings with Ivy Tech staff and high school/career center administration.
  • Serve as an Ivy Tech Community College representative in high schools.
  • Plan campus visits for their schools.
  • Meet with students on campus for admissions and dual enrollment appointments.
  • Position will spend several months post initial hire on the Ivy Tech Community College Bloomington campus to receive comprehensive training around the College and Career Coach role.
  • Additionally, the position will work on the Ivy Tech Community College Bloomington campus when the high schools are closed for summer break, winter break, etc.
  • Other duties logically associated with this position may be assigned.
  • All responsibilities will be conducted within the parameters of the Family Educational Rights and Privacy Act (FERPA), other applicable regulatory requirements, and professional standards.
